WebNov 19, 2024 · The Post-9/11 GI Bill can pay your full tuition & fees at school, provide you with a monthly housing allowance while you are going to school, and give you up to $1,000 a year to use for books and ... WebThe Post-9/11 GI Bill offers higher-education and training benefits to veterans and service members who served after Sept. 10, 2001, as well as to their families. Benefits include: Tuition funds are paid directly to the school, while the housing allowance and book stipend are paid directly to the student. http://www.careeraftermilitary.com/faq/can-you-go-to-law-school-on-the-gi-bill/ WebWe’ll match the amount your school contributes to the program. So if your school funds $3,000 of your tuition, we’ll also pay $3,000 to your school, and you’ll be covered for the full amount. If your school funds $2,000 through the Yellow Ribbon Program, we’ll also pay $2,000 to your school, and you’ll need to pay the remaining $2,000.

WebWith that, I qualified for Vocational Rehabilitation and transfered my G.I. Bill to their Chapter and received 100% of the BAH and tuition and fees were paid in full. Not to mention, I got to keep financial aid which was a $5k reimbursement each year. This program paid for my BSW, temporary law school journey, and my MSW.
